The Augusta Police Department released the description Monday night of a suspect allegedly connected to an armed robbery at Camden National Bank in Augusta.

A man police suspect may have been involved in an armed robbery Saturday at Camden National Bank at 21 Armory St. in Augusta is seen on video surveillance. Photo courtesy of the Augusta Police Department

The suspect is described as a white male between 5 feet 7 inches and 5 feet 10 inches tall and 150 to 180 pounds, according to Deputy Chief Kevin D. Lully.

In a photograph released by police, the suspect is wearing a brown hat, a light-colored protective mask, a dark jacket and dark athletic pants, possibly with a light stripe.

Lully said a person who called police about the robbery said the suspect entered the bank at 21 Armory St., displayed a gun and demanded an undisclosed amount of money.

The suspect fled before police arrived and has not been identified, according to Lully.

Augusta police Sgt. Todd Nyberg said Sunday no one was hurt during the robbery.

Nyberg said he could not confirm money was stolen because he had not spoken with detectives.

Officials ask that anyone with information on the suspect call Augusta police at 207-626-2370.
